Transaction 76b96cc1e30c6a884f4a8a822d9ebaa4bc0e7e76c3cb0c23af0c4d663a72c81f

44 Input
1 Outputs
  • 76b96cc1e30c6a884f4a8a822d9ebaa4bc0e7e76c3cb0c23af0c4d663a72c81f:0
  • value  5449691
    address  38DYjdGWahNAg9hxmDavP2pVLxY7NK2LSA